database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 30013 게시물 읽기
No. 30013
/mysql: 인수 명단이 너무 김
작성자
김승철
작성일
2011-06-17 13:49
조회수
7,679

안녕하세요

이상한 문제가 있어 여쭈어봅니다

query 를 shell로 해서 아래와같이 날립니다

 

mysql -uroot -pxxxxx -e "insert into abc ~~~~~~~~~~~~"  database

그런데 쿼리가 좀 깁니다  필드하나가 mediumtext 라 몇천개의 문자들이 한라인에 들어가는데

이렇게 되니까 /mysql: 인수 명단이 너무 김 이라는 오류가 나더군요

그래서 mediumtext 로 들어가는 필드의 값을 조금 줄였더니 들어갑니다

반드시 1개 라인으로 해서 쿼리를 날려서 들어갈수 있어야 하는데요 방법이 없을까요

조언주시면 감사하겠습니다

이 글에 대한 댓글이 총 1건 있습니다.

 query 작성후. 호출하는 식으로 변경하시면 될 듯합니다.

 

mysql의 source 사용하세요. help에서 찾아보시면 됩니다.

source    (\.) Execute an SQL script file. Takes a file name as an argument.

 

송장원(jnjill)님이 2011-06-23 17:47에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
30017도와주세요. ㅠㅠ mysqlbinlog 에 관한 질문입니다.
도와주세요
2011-06-29
7459
30016SELECT - WHERE절 질문드립니다. [1]
렘스
2011-06-24
7109
30014RAISE_APPLICATION_ERROR 기능문의
박세정
2011-06-23
7322
30013/mysql: 인수 명단이 너무 김 [1]
김승철
2011-06-17
7679
30012mysql의 InnoDB의 row level 락킹 관련 질문입니다.
정수화
2011-06-16
9084
30011다중 테이블 select 구문 [1]
노인철
2011-06-15
8543
30010다중 row 를 하나의 row로 가져 오려면 [2]
다중열
2011-06-15
8118
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.4로 자료를 관리합니다